We’re seeking a future team member for the role of Associate, Client Reporting/Performance I to join our Performance team. This role is located in Pune.
In this role, you’ll make an impact in the following ways:
- Join a dynamic team, working closely with Portfolio Managers and Performance Analysts, playing an integral role in calculating Daily and Monthly returns for various reporting purposes.
- Calculate index, fund, and client returns (Daily, Monthly, Yearly) for Active and Indexing strategies.
- Perform Attribution analysis for Active and Indexing strategies.
- Reconcile cash flows between systems.
- Identify Corporate Action events impacting the performance of accounts and funds.
- Detect pricing issues affecting account and fund performance.
- Conduct account research to finalize returns.
- Address performance-related ad hoc queries from Portfolio Managers, Client Relationship teams, and RFP/RFQ teams.
To be successful in this role, we’re seeking the following:
- Bachelor’s or Master’s degree with 2-3 years of relevant experience.
- Hands-on experience in Performance Measurement and Attribution.
- Basic understanding of Power BI and Excel macros.
- Familiarity with Aladdin and FactSet is a plus.
